Many people wonder whether virtual therapy can truly help. For common concerns such as stress, anxiety, depression, relationship difficulties, or navigating life changes, online therapy can be as effective as traditional in-person sessions.
A major benefit is flexibility – clients can choose the format that best fits their schedules and comfort level, whether that is video calls, phone sessions, live chat, or messaging within an app. This convenience often makes it easier to maintain regular care.
Licensed professionals provide online care, and clients have the option to switch therapists if they need a different fit. For many people managing everyday mental health needs, online therapy offers an accessible and practical way to get support.
